Specifications and engine design

At the heart of the model is a two-stroke internal combustion engine with forced air cooling and water cooling of the exhaust system. The cylinder displacement is 49 cubic centimeters, which formally places it in the class of up to 5 hp, but the actual power on the propeller often varies. Magnum Pro 3.8 is a monoblock structure where the crankcase, cylinder and silencer are combined into a single unit.

The ignition system here is electronic (CDI), which saves the owner from having to adjust the gaps of the contact interrupter, as it was in older engines. The fuel mixture is prepared in a float-type carburetor, which requires periodic cleaning, especially if you use low-quality gasoline. The engine weight in running order is about 9.8 kg, which makes it easy to carry with one hand.

The gearshift system is particularly noteworthy, and it's done by turning the hummel forward-neutral-back, and the cranking mechanism is pretty robust, but it requires lubrication with a consistent lubricant over long periods of storage. Plunge The engine at low revs is quite sufficient for trolling, but at high speeds of rotation there is a lack of power for glides with full load.

⚠️ Warning: Do not attempt to reach maximum speeds on the motor without the water intake tube installed or outside the water. This will cause instantaneous overheating and deformation of the exhaust pipe, as cooling of the muffler is carried out only with off-shore water.

Features of operation and fuel mixture

Proper preparation of the fuel mixture is the key to a long life for your family. boat-engineBecause the engine is two-stroke, it doesn't have a separate lubrication system for the crank-shaft mechanism, and the lubrication is shared with the fuel, so the quality of the oil and the mixing proportions are critical.

For the new engine, it is recommended to use a ratio of 1:25 (40 ml of oil per 1 liter of gasoline). After the first 10 hours, when the rubbing parts are rubbed, you can switch to a standard mixture of 1:50 (20 ml of oil per 1 liter of gasoline). You need to use only special oils for two-stroke outboard motors marked TC-W3. Automotive oils for motorcycles 2T will not work here, as they are designed for air cooling and can form a scoll.

Gasoline should be used with an AI-92 or an AI-95, but it is worth remembering that high-octane gasoline with a lot of additives can lose its properties faster when stored. If you plan to store a boat with fuel in a tank for more than a month, you better drain the residues or use fuel stabilizers.

πŸ’‘

Use a transparent dividing tank to mix oil and gasoline. It is almost impossible to determine a 1:50 ratio on the eye, and the oil poured on the eye often leads to either candles being coked or bullies in the cylinder.

The mixing process also has its nuances: first, half the required volume of gasoline is poured into the tank, then all the oil is added, the mixture is carefully shaken, then the remaining gasoline is added and mixed again, the finished mixture is recommended to be kept for 10-15 minutes before pouring into the engine tank.

breaking in process: step-by-step instructions

Many beginners make the mistake of starting from full speed immediately after purchase, a gross violation that can reduce the life of the engine by many times. break-in necessary for laundry of piston rings to walls of cylinder and bearings of crankshaft.

The first run is better done on a stand with a barrel of water or directly on a boat, but with caution. It is important to ensure that water enters the cooling system (the control jet must go confidently), the break-in process takes about 10 motor hours and is divided into several stages.

During the first hours of operation, don't keep the humming wheel in one position all the time. Change the speeds periodically, let the engine breathe. If you notice that the engine is losing power or there are extraneous vibrations, the process should be stopped and the spark plugs checked. The ignition candle should be in brick color; black lobe indicates a rich mixture, white - poor.

After the first two hours of operation, it is recommended to let the engine cool down and check the tightening of the muffler and carburetor mount bolts, as they may weaken from vibration.

Typical malfunctions and methods of their elimination

Like any technique, Magnum Pro 3.8 It's not without childhood diseases. Most often, users have problems starting or idling at unstable speeds, and the main reason is the way the carburetor is assembled and set up from the factory.

If the engine doesn't start, the first thing you do is check for a spark, twist the candle, put a high-voltage wire tip on it, and thread it against the engine metal (mass). Pull the starter sharply. If there are no sparks, the problem may be the ignition coil or the Stop button, which may have oxidized from moisture.

The engine starts and dies? It's probably a carburetor's jellyboxes or there's air in the fuel system. It's also a common problem to suck air through the gasket between the carburetor and the cylinder, in which case the engine will only run at high speeds, and on idle ones it will stall.

⚠️ Attention: When disassembling the carburetor, carefully monitor the integrity of the diaphragm. Rubber from time to time and poor-quality gasoline can suffocate or crack, which will lead to a violation of tightness.

Another common problem is cutting the propeller veneer. If the propeller is spinning and the boat is not swimming or is swimming very slowly, check the veneer. This motor uses soft veneers that are cut off when hit by underwater obstacles, protecting the gearbox from breakdown.

Comparison with competitors and choice of screw

There are many analogues on the market, such as Tohatsu, Yamaha or Hidea. Magnum Pro 3.8 The main advantage is the price and availability of parts, and it structurally replicates many time-tested models, so finding a piston, rings, or carburetor is easy.

However, noise and vibration levels may be inferior to more expensive Japanese counterparts. Daidvus metal and casting quality are also average. For infrequent use (5-10 trips per season), this is a great option, but for commercial use or frequent long-distance hikes, it is better to consider more expensive brands.

An important element is propeller. The regular propeller often has a pitch that is not optimal for specific conditions (boat weight, number of passengers); Experimenting with propellers of different pitches can significantly improve acceleration dynamics. For heavy PVC boats with two passengers, it makes sense to try a propeller with a reduced pitch, so that the engine can more easily enter mode.

Tips for Winter Storage and Conservation

To start the engine from half-turn next season, it must be properly preserved. You can't leave gasoline in the carburetor for the winter - the light fractions will evaporate, and the resinous substances will clog the jellyplants. The best way is to develop the remaining fuel or completely drain them.

After the fuel is drained, it is recommended to wrap some oil (about 10-15 ml) in the cylinder and turn the crankshaft with a starter several times, this will create an oil film on the cylinder mirror and protect it from corrosion during downtime, it is better to store the engine in an upright position, in a dry room.

Remember to lubricate all external metal parts, gas cable and gear shift mechanism with special conservation lubricant. This will prevent rust from getting from moist air. FAQ: Frequently asked questions

Can this motor be used in seawater?

Theoretically, you can, but after each exit, you need to thoroughly wash the engine with fresh water. Daydvus aluminum alloys and pump impellers are susceptible to corrosion in a salty environment.

Which petrol is better to pour: 92 or 95?

The engine is designed for the AI-92, and 95th gasoline is acceptable, but it doesn't add power, it just increases knock resistance, which is not critical for this engine, and the main thing is freshness of the fuel.

Why does the engine smoke when it's working?

Plenty of white smoke is normal for a two-stroke engine, especially during break-in or enriched mixture. If the smoke is black and has a pungent smell, check the proportion of the oil and the condition of the candles.

Where's the lower unit drain screw?

Water discharge holes are usually located at the bottom of the lower unit, and must be opened after each operation so that the water does not freeze inside and burst the pump case in winter.
